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 28 is 28
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 28 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 7 = 28,
16/4 = 16 × 7/4 × 7 = 112/28 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 1 = 28,
7/28 = 7 × 1/28 × 1 = 7/28 - Add the two like fractions:
112/28 + 7/28 = 112 + 7/28 = 119/28 - 119/28 simplified gives 17/4
- So, 16/4 + 7/28 = 17/4
